A Marriage Of High Tech And High Touch!

For this week, I thought I would provide some insight and background on the recent changes at Healthways. On July 27, 2016, Healthways sold its Total Population Health Services and Emerging Markets business to Sharecare, founded in 2010 by internet entrepreneur, Jeff Arnold and Dr. Mehmet Oz, renowned cardiac surgeon and TV personality.
